The position of IT Infrastructure Engineer is focused on assisting with the design, deployment, validation, and implementation of scalable solutions within infrastructure, networking, cloud, and security with efficiency, confidence, and competence. The role will report directly to the Director of Saas Infrastructure.
The IT Infrastructure Engineer will be the expert on maintenance and upgrade of infrastructure including servers, email delivery systems, storage, routers, switches, firewalls, remote access systems, and network management systems in accordance with best practices and established processes
Duties/Responsibilities:
- Install, configure, and tune Java Application servers including Tomcat, some JBoss
- Install, configure, and tune Docker services
- Troubleshoot Java applications on Linux, UNIX, and Windows
- Managing VMware vSphere or other virtualization technology
- Troubleshoot system hardware provide, failure analysis, and recovery
- Troubleshoot network issues related to WAN and LAN access to Java applications and other network accessible services (SFTP, DNS, SSH, VPN, Mail, Apache)
- Installation of database servers (Oracle, MYSQL, MSSQL Server)
- Develop and research new automation and technology opportunities
- Provide 24x7 Tier III Production environment on call support
- Drives documentation of architecture and testing of infrastructure
- Interface directly and indirectly with client staff and 3rd party vendors both technical and non-technical.
Required Skills/Abilities:
- Experience in Infrastructure and Operations services
- Experience in Enterprise Cloud Migration and Transformation
- Working knowledge of implementing and managing backup systems such as Veeam
- Understanding of networking and network virtualization required
- Advance analytic and troubleshooting skills for problems that span multiple domains (application, network, system, hardware)
Education and Experience:
- Bachelor’s Degree in MIS or CIS or equivalent experience
- 5 years of professional experience with Red Hat, CentOS, Rocky Linux
- Experience with VMware vSphere or Red Hat KVM based virtual machines
- Experience with hosting Java Web Application
- Experience with Cloud Management Software (Oracle Cloud, OpenStack, Microsoft Azure or Amazon Web Services)
- Experience with continuous integration and deployment automation tools such as Jenkins, Hudson, and Nexus.
- 5 years of experience with Apache web server or NGINX
- 2-4 years of Advance scripting (Perl or Bash)
- 1-3 years Zabbix or other IT Infrastructure monitoring software system
- Experience running MySQL clustered databases
- 3-5 years windows server experience including domain administration
- Experience with Docker compose or Puppet for infrastructure provisioning tools